1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is mass?

Back

Mass is the amount of matter in an object, usually measured in grams or kilograms.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is volume?

Back

Volume is the amount of space an object occupies, typically measured in liters or cubic centimeters.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What unit is used to measure mass in the metric system?

Back

Gram (g) is the unit used to measure mass.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the basic unit of length in the metric system?

Back

The meter (m) is the basic unit of length.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How does weight change on different planets?

Back

Weight changes on different planets due to the varying gravitational pull.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ula for calculating the volume of a rectangular prism?

Back

Volume = length × width × height.
